A leak traced back to its actual source, rather than just patched where the damage shows, is what genuinely ends the problem.
- Your last water bill was noticeably higher with no clear reason why
- A ceiling or wall patch has dried out once before and come back
- You can hear water moving somewhere with everything switched off
- There's a musty or damp smell that doesn't trace to anywhere obvious
- The meter is still turning over even though nothing's running

How to Know It's Time for Water Leak Detection
A bill that's climbed for no clear reason, or the sound of water moving through the walls when nothing's turned on, both warrant a genuine trace. A tap dripping at the same rate it always has isn't worth that level of digging.

Water Leak Detection FAQs
Common questions before booking a trace in Rose Bay.
Does the price change if you discover extra faults?
Only with your approval first. You'll see the extra fault and agree the figure before anything more is touched.
Is there anything to clear or switch off before the visit?
Just clear access to the suspected area. The isolation and testing side is handled by the crew.
How long does water leak detection usually take?
Sorting a leak that's easy to get to often happens in one visit; digging one out from behind a slab or deep in a cavity sometimes needs a follow-up.
Can water leak detection legally be done by anyone but a licensed plumber?
No. NSW law keeps this kind of tracing and repair strictly with licensed plumbers.
What usually causes this problem?
Most often it's a seal that's failed somewhere under the floor or inside a cavity, though ageing pipework contributes plenty on its own.
Is water leak detection harder in older houses?
Sometimes, since original fittings and pipe runs aren't always where a newer build would put them, but it rarely slows the trace down much.
